left to right: Rep. Devin Carney, Sen. Paul Formica and Sen. Art Linares on Feb. 4 joined with state transportation officials and Lt. Gov. Nancy Wyman for a ribbon-cutting ceremony to mark the opening of the new 200-space parking lot at the Old Saybrook train station. The lot at 455 Boston Post Road will bring the total number of parking spaces to 324.
